I remember feeling a little disappointed after watching the 1st episodes of the Justice League series. Some bad decisions (in my opinion) regarding characters design and some dull plots have led me to the conclusion that the new series would never reach the same level of entertainment from the previous BATMAN / SUPERMAN shows. I am happy to say that I was wrong.
Justice League has grown in quality during its 1st two seasons and every new episode turned out to be better than the previous one. Even the characters design issues were solved. The 2nd season of the series presents some of the greatest stories from all DC Comics animated series. After Season 2 final episode, the creative team responsible for the series embraced the challenge of taking the series to another level by creating the Justice League Unlimited, a group of super heroes formed by as many "good guys" from the DC Comics Universe as possible. The result was great! Justice League Unlimited - Season 1 presents what I consider to be the best arc of stories from all of DC Comics Animated Series. It is hard to say more without revealing important aspects of the series, but I don't think I'll be telling much if I say that this particular arc involves a complex plot and offers a new perspective about super heroes: Is it a good idea to have so much power in the hands of few super heroes? The search for the answer for such question resulted in a great development for the series and a must-have collection for all DC Comics fans. Justice League Unlimited - Season 2 is good entertainment too, although not as great as Season 1. But it definitely concludes the whole Justice League series beautifully and lets us fans wishing for more episodes... I really hope that happens someday.

When the original Justice League series ended, Hawkgirl was out of the group and the remaining members vowed to rebuild their organization. BOY, did they ever as virtually every character in the DC Universe makes an appearance during these final two seasons.
The episodes have already been covered by other reviews so I'll just go into the highlights of both seasons of JLU. Season 1: *The Cabnus angle and how Lex Luthor was manipulating things behinds the scenes. *Seeing The Flash get busy and actually step up and be a real hero in one of the final episodes of Season 1. *The Once & Future Thing, Pts. 1 & 2 - New revelations that will change things for 3 JLU members. *New revelations about the future Batman, Terry McGuinus which should've been the finale for Batman Beyond but I am glad its here on JLU! Season 2: *The Legion Of Doom makes their appearance. *More revelations about Hawkgirl and Green Lantern *Hawkman (the real one) appears *Supergirl comes into her own and The Legion Of Super Heroes make their first appearance since Superman: The Animated Series. *Darkseid returns for one more fight with Superman and the JLU Overall, a good collection to add to your DVD's! As usual, has something for kids but sophisticated enough for adults.
